Clinic Appointment--August 20, 2010

I had my clinic appointment on August 20th. This is the first time I've been able to get online to post about it.
It went great!!
My PFT's went back up. They went from 91% to 94%. So we've officially ruled out the Generic Zithromax as the cause to the decrease back in May from 96% to 91%.
We've decided that the cause of the drop back in May was due to allergies or the weather.
So thankful that my numbers went back up and I am healthy.
I will admit I was a little nervous, a little concerned that they may have decreased more, but when I was blowing mid 90's on the screen it felt good. It made me really happy. :)
Jerry was really happy and proud of me too.
Dr. Whittaker-LeClair came into the room asked me the regular questions and felt my stomach and that was the extent of the appointment. My 6 month is in November and before I go to it, I have to get my yearly Glucose Screening done.
I hate those. :(
You have to drink this horrible sugar drink, I usually get the Lemon-Lime one, it tastes like really flat Sprite. But the worst part, is the having to sit for 2 hours at the hospital, I can't leave.
But I drink the drink, sometimes they draw blood at the hour mark, sometimes they don't, but they always draw blood at the end of the 2 hours. Then I can leave.

Acapella

I finally got my new Acapella the other day, I used it for the first time last night. It has so much more power, it pushes a lot stronger vibration into my lungs than my old one.
I coughed up a lot of mucus. I thought at one point I was going to throw up from how hard I was coughing.
Everyone tells me how surprised and proud they were that I finally made the decision to become a little more independent. I don't blame them, I used to be very determined to not change how things went.
But now that I am, it's making Jerry's life easier and also my life easier. I'm now able to go and spend time with my friends and sleep over their houses.
Just like next week, I'm spending three days at my friend Kendra's house with her two daughters, Leah and Rachel. It's very exciting, it'll be my very first time away from home where I don't need someone there to do my Chest PT, it'll just be me. I've never been able to experience that, now I can.
I'm hoping to post a video at some point of me using my new Acapella. Jerry said he would video tape me using it, so that everyone can see how it works. I mention the Acapella to people, and some CFers have never heard of it. That surprised me. I thought everyone would have known about it.  It's similar to the Flutter, you do the same breathing techniques, but it looks a little like the AeroChamber that you would put your inhalers into.
